Update on ATP’s (Association of Test Publishers South Africa) position statement on the Employment Equity Act

Following a position statement released by the ATP in October 2014 which commented on changes made by the Department of Labour to the Employment Equity Act No 55 of 1998, further developments have ensued.

The recent amendment prohibited the use of psychological tests and similar assessments unless they had been certified by the Health Professions Council of South Africa (HPCSA). The ATP responded by proposing a meeting between themselves and the HPCSA to discuss the implications around this. This meeting also aimed to charter a way toward fostering productive collaboration and open communication between the Professional Council, the ATP and relevant stakeholders.
